Putin and Trump's Reluctance to Admit Failure Blocks Peace in Ukraine and Iran

By

Marc Champion

10d ago· 1 min readenInsight

Summary

The article discusses two major ongoing wars (Ukraine and Iran) that are highly destructive and risk escalating into great-power conflicts. It argues both conflicts are ripe for settlement because the attacking sides have little prospect of achieving their goals through continued fighting. The main obstacle to peace is the reluctance of Vladimir Putin and Donald Trump to admit failure and explain the disproportionate costs of these wars to their constituents.
